95. An Honest Review of Thumper Forge’s “The Chaos Apple”
Well, it must be May, because I’m doing another book review! This time around I’m reviewing Thumper Forge’s “The Chaos Apple” (ISBN 9780738775432) which came out last fall. It is, unsurprisingly, a book on Chaos Magic – a topic it turns out I knew more about than I realized. And while overall I liked this book a lot, it does have one glaring issue for me… but only because I’m a pedantic nerd. The annual Q&A/Feedback episode is coming up! 95. Space Scamps – Oh Good, Another Breeding Program!
Miles and Charlie have come down with a case of the ‘too British for Star Trek’ and are coping with it the only way they know how, by once more becoming Space Scamps and hopping over to Moonbase Alpha for three more episodes of Space 1999! We’ve an unintentional theme of guest stars here as ‘Force of Life’ gives us a young Ian McShane coming down with a bad case of heat vamperism, while ‘Alpha Child’ gives us evil children, weird cosmic space incest with Julian Glover (he’s been in a lot of stuff). Finally, ‘Missing Link‘ gives us a guest turn by Peter Cushing in a costume choice slightly more dignified than Christopher Lee back in Space Scamps II, and Charlie asks us a terrifying question: why have we not watched any season 2 yet… EPISODES MENTIONED: Force of Life (09:14) Alpha Child (28:58) Missing Link (50:53) TALKING POINTS: The Abominable Dr. Phibes, New Classic Doctor Who, The Employees, The House on the Borderland, Sailing, Rhinestone Cowboy, a very young Ian McShane who to Miles’ surprise is NOT playing a scumbag, coworkers coming into work while sick, Space 1999’s production values ALWAYS impress, Sunshine is a great movie, is this incest?
